    What to do if nothing happens when I press buttons on my Clarion M455 Car Receiver?
    • C
      Courtney CarterAug 25, 2025
      If nothing happens when you press the buttons on your Clarion Car Receiver, the microprocessor may have malfunctioned. Turn off the power, then press the [RELEASE] button and remove the DCP. Press the reset button for about 2 seconds with a thin rod.

    Why is there no sound output when operating Clarion M455 with amplifiers?
    • W
      Whitney WhiteAug 27, 2025
      If there is no sound output when operating your Clarion Car Receiver with amplifiers, the amplifier turn-on lead might be shorted to ground or require excessive current. Turn the unit off and check each wire for a possible short. If the amplifier turn-on lead shorts out, cover it with insulation such as tape.

    Why does Clarion Car Receiver sound bad directly after power is turned on?
    • M
      Mark HernandezSep 6, 2025
      If the sound is bad directly after the power is turned on for your Clarion Car Receiver, water droplets may have formed on the internal lens. Let it dry for about 1 hour with the power on.
